Top Destinations & Neighborhoods in Faro
Faro’s compact and walkable city center is a treasure trove of history, culture, and lively entertainment. Here are the must-visit neighborhoods and attractions:
- Old Town (Cidade Velha): Wander through narrow cobblestone streets, admire medieval walls, visit the Faro Cathedral, and explore charming plazas filled with cafes and shops.
- Vilamoura: A short drive from Faro, this upscale resort area boasts world-famous golf courses, luxury marinas, and vibrant nightlife.
- Praia de Faro: The bustling beach town with golden sands, water sports, beach bars, and lively restaurants perfect for daytime relaxation and evening fun.
Experience Faro’s Rich History & Culture
Faro is steeped in history dating back to Roman times, blended seamlessly with modern vibrancy. Top cultural highlights include:
- Faro Cathedral: Climb to the top for panoramic views and explore the Gothic architecture and archaeological museum inside.
- Municipal Museum: Dive into Faro’s past with exhibits on archaeological finds, religious art, and local heritage.
- Market of Faro (Mercado Municipal): Visit this lively market to sample fresh local produce, regional cheeses, cured meats, and baked goods while mingling with friendly vendors.

Activities & Adventures: Make the Most of Your Holiday in Faro
Faro is a playground for outdoor enthusiasts and curious explorers alike. Here are some activities to add to your holiday itinerary:
- Boat Tours & Island Hopping: Discover the stunning Ria Formosa Lagoon with guided boat trips to secluded islands like Ilha Deserta and Ilha da Culatra. Enjoy birdwatching, swimming, and picnicking on pristine beaches.
- Beach Days & Water Sports: Lounge on Praia de Faro’s sandy stretches, try surfing, paddleboarding, or jet skiing for a rush of adrenaline.
- Golfing: Tee off at world-class golf courses like Oceanico Victoria Golf Course, just a short drive away.
- Biking & Walking Tours: Rent bikes or join guided tours to explore Faro’s scenic coastal paths, nature reserves, and hidden gems.

Local Experiences & Insider Tips
To truly embrace Faro’s lively spirit, participate in local experiences that go beyond typical sightseeing. Here are some insider tips:
- Participate in a Cooking Class: Learn to prepare traditional Portuguese dishes like cataplana, piri-piri chicken, or pastel de nata with local chefs.
- Shop at Faro’s Markets: Engage with vendors at Mercado Municipal and pick up regional ingredients to cook your own Portuguese feast.
- Attend a Fado Night: Experience soulful Portuguese music in intimate venues for an authentic cultural night.
- Visit Local Art Galleries: Explore Faro’s contemporary and traditional art scenes at spaces like Galeria Municipal de Faro.
- Join a Birdwatching Excursion: Ria Formosa is a sanctuary for birdlife, and guided tours are perfect for nature lovers.
Planning Your Faro Vacation: Practical Tips
Getting the most out of your Faro holiday involves some planning:
- Best Time to Visit: Spring (April to June) and Fall (September to October) offer pleasant weather, fewer crowds, and excellent outdoor conditions.
- Transportation: Faro has an excellent bus and taxi system. Renting a car provides greater flexibility, especially for exploring the wider Algarve region.
- Language: Portuguese is the official language, but English is widely spoken in tourist areas.
- Currency: The Euro (€) is the accepted currency.
- Safety & Local Etiquette: Faro is a friendly city; respect local customs, be mindful of the environment, and always support local businesses.
